AutoomStudioLogoS-1-1024x250

How We Do Custom Software Development

Crafting Software Solutions for Your Unique Needs

At Autoom Studio, we specialise in creating custom software tailored precisely to your requirements. Whether you need a user-friendly interface, specific functionalities, or seamless integration with existing systems, our team is here to transform your ideas into efficient, user-centric software. Let us be your partner in bringing your vision to life through personalised software development.

Requirement Analysis

Custom Software Development

Embark on a collaborative journey with our expert team as we delve deep into understanding your business objectives. Our requirement analysis service is not just about gathering specifications; it’s about unravelling the intricacies of your vision and translating them into precise software requirements.

Key Features:

  • Comprehensive Consultation: Our team engages in extensive discussions to gain profound insights into your business goals.
  • Thorough Examination: We meticulously scrutinise your current systems and potential challenges to anticipate and address future needs.
  • Collaborative Workshops: Through collaborative workshops, we facilitate open communication, ensuring every stakeholder’s perspective is considered.
  • Continuous Feedback Loops: Iterative feedback loops guarantee that our understanding aligns accurately with your evolving vision.

How We Work:

  • Our process involves a series of interactive workshops and brainstorming sessions.
  • We believe in the power of open communication, where your domain expertise is combined with our technical proficiency.
  • Continuous feedback loops ensure that our understanding is always up-to-date, allowing us to adapt and refine requirements as needed. 

Design and Architecture

Elevate your software experience with our design and architecture service, where we go beyond aesthetics to create intelligent blueprints. Our expert architects ensure that your software not only looks good but is also scalable, robust, and aligned with your brand identity.

Key Features:

  • Expert Architects: Our team comprises seasoned architects with a wealth of experience in creating robust and scalable software structures.
  • Intuitive UI/UX Design: We prioritise user satisfaction by crafting intuitive user interfaces and seamless user experiences.
  • Iterative Design Processes: Our design evolves through iterative processes, ensuring real-time client feedback is incorporated at every stage.
  • Seamless Visual Appeal: Emphasis on creating a visually appealing environment that resonates with your brand identity.

How We Work:

  • Our design and architecture process involves a close partnership with your team.
  • We employ a user-centric approach, focusing on creating designs that not only meet technical specifications but also enhance user satisfaction.
  • Iterative design cycles ensure that the final product aligns seamlessly with your expectations.

Development

Experience excellence in code with our proficient development team. We go beyond writing lines of code; we sculpt intelligent solutions that are not only functional but also scalable, efficient, and maintainable.

Key Features:

  • Cutting-edge Technologies: Our developers stay updated with the latest technologies, ensuring your software is developed with the best tools available.
  • Agile Methodology: We embrace an agile methodology for rapid and adaptive development, allowing for flexibility and quick adjustments.
  • Continuous Collaboration: We believe in continuous collaboration with our clients, ensuring that the development process is transparent and aligned with your evolving vision.
  • Code Optimization: Our codebase is optimised for scalability, efficiency, and ease of maintenance.

How We Work:

  • Our development process is characterised by transparency and adaptability.
  • Regular sprints, client showcases, and feedback loops are integral to our methodology.
  • We prioritise clean and efficient coding practices to deliver a robust end product.

Quality Assurance (QA) and Testing

Ensure the reliability of your software with our comprehensive QA and testing services. We go beyond finding bugs; we meticulously validate every aspect of your software, ensuring a seamless and reliable user experience.

Key Features:

  • Comprehensive Testing Protocols: Our testing covers functionality, security, and performance, ensuring every aspect is thoroughly validated.
  • Automated and Manual Testing: We employ a combination of automated and manual testing to guarantee robust software quality.
  • Iterative QA Cycles: Continuous QA cycles ensure that our software evolves with the changing needs, and issues are resolved promptly.
  • Customised Testing Strategies: We tailor our testing strategies based on the unique requirements of each project.

How We Work:

  • Our QA team is committed to ensuring the highest quality standards.
  • We use a combination of automated tools and manual testing to cover a wide range of scenarios.
  • Iterative QA cycles, coupled with feedback from the development team, ensure that the software is not only free of defects but also continuously improved.

Deployment

Experience a seamless transition with our meticulous deployment strategies. We understand that deployment is more than just a technical process; it’s about ensuring minimal downtime and providing immediate support for a smooth transition.

Key Features:

  • Detailed Deployment Plans: We create detailed plans to minimise downtime and streamline the deployment process.
  • Post-deployment Support: Immediate support is provided to address any issues and ensure a smooth user adoption process.
  • Continuous Monitoring: We continuously monitor the deployment phase to identify and address any unexpected challenges.
  • Robust Contingency Plans: Our strategies include robust contingency plans to handle unforeseen circumstances.

How We Work:

  • Our deployment process involves meticulous planning and execution.
  • We focus not only on the technical aspects but also on the user experience during the transition.
  • Continuous monitoring allows us to address any issues promptly, ensuring a smooth and efficient deployment.

Want to try our services?

Request a Demo

Maintenance and Support

Sustain the excellence of your software with our proactive maintenance and support services. We don’t just fix issues; we proactively monitor and optimise performance to keep your software running seamlessly.

Key Features:

  • Proactive Monitoring: We monitor your software proactively, identifying and addressing potential issues before they impact your operations.
  • Swift Issue Resolution: Our support team ensures swift issue resolution, minimising downtime and disruptions.
  • Continuous Performance Optimization: Regular updates and patches are applied to optimise both security and functionality.
  • Customizable Support Plans: Support plans are tailored to your evolving needs, providing flexibility and adaptability.

How We Work:

  • Our maintenance and support services are designed to be proactive rather than reactive.
  • Through continuous monitoring, we ensure that potential issues are identified and resolved before they impact your business.
  • Customizable support plans provide the flexibility needed to adapt to your evolving requirements.

Integration

Achieve seamless system integration with our expert services. We understand that integration is not just about connecting systems; it’s about creating a harmonious environment where data flows seamlessly between different components.

Key Features:

  • Expert Integration: Our team specialises in integrating diverse software ecosystems, ensuring smooth interoperability.
  • API-driven Solutions: We leverage API-driven solutions to facilitate seamless communication and data exchange.
  • Effortless Collaboration: We ensure that the integration process promotes effortless collaboration between existing and new systems.
  • Streamlined Data Flow: Our solutions are designed to optimise data flow, enhancing overall system efficiency.

How We Work:

  • Our integration process begins with a comprehensive analysis of your existing systems.
  • We then develop and implement solutions that ensure a seamless flow of data between different components.
  • API-driven approaches and thorough testing guarantee that the integration is smooth and effective.

Consulting and Project Management

Benefit from strategic guidance and effective project management throughout your software development journey. Our consulting services are designed to align technology with your business objectives, and our project management ensures timely and on-budget delivery.

Key Features:

  • Strategic Consulting: We provide strategic consulting services to align technology solutions with your broader business objectives.
  • Project Management Expertise: Our project managers bring extensive expertise to ensure projects are delivered on time and within budget.
  • Continuous Communication: We prioritise continuous communication and transparency, keeping you informed at every step.
  • Future-proofing Investments: Consulting services include future-proofing your software investments, ensuring longevity and adaptability.

How We Work:

  • Our consulting and project management services start with a deep understanding of your business goals.
  • We work closely with you to align technology solutions with these goals.
  • Through effective project management, we ensure that timelines and budgets are adhered to, and continuous communication keeps you informed and involved.

Want to try our services?

Request a Demo

Customization and Upgrades

Adapt your software to changing business needs with our customization and upgrade services. We go beyond providing off-the-shelf solutions; we tailor our offerings to ensure your software evolves seamlessly with your business.

Key Features:

  • Customization Options: Our solutions come with customization options, allowing your software to adapt to changing business requirements.
  • Seamless Upgrades: We provide seamless upgrades to ensure your software stays ahead of technological advancements.
  • Flexibility in Solutions: Our solutions are designed with flexibility in mind, allowing them to grow with your business.
  • Future-proofing Investments: Customization and upgrade services play a crucial role in future-proofing your software investments.

How We Work:

  • Our customization and upgrade services are driven by a deep understanding of your business evolution.
  • We provide options for tailoring software solutions to meet specific needs and ensure that seamless upgrades keep your software at the forefront of technological advancements.

Security Implementation

Ensure the security of your digital assets with our robust security implementation. We understand that security is not a one-time event but an ongoing process of fortifying your digital fortress against evolving threats.

Key Features:

  • Robust Security Protocols: Our security implementation includes robust protocols for safeguarding sensitive data.
  • Regular Security Audits: We conduct regular security audits to identify vulnerabilities and proactively address potential threats.
  • Compliance with Industry Standards: Our security measures are aligned with industry standards, ensuring comprehensive data protection.
  • Continuous Monitoring: Security implementation involves continuous monitoring to stay ahead of emerging threats.

How We Work:

  • Security implementation is integrated into every phase of our software development process.
  • From design to deployment, robust security protocols are in place.
  • Regular security audits and compliance checks guarantee that your digital assets are protected, and continuous monitoring ensures quick response to emerging threats.
Choose your Service(s):